2B:21-1. Number of grand juries
The Assignment Judge for each county shall impanel one or more grand juries for that county, as the public interest requires. There shall be at least one grand jury serving in each county at all times.
Source: 2A:71-5; 2A:71-6; 2A:71-7
L.1995,c.44,s.1.
